Bastrop Yesterfest |
|
Yesterfest is held in April each year. You will experience a wide variety of activities depicting the different times of Bastrop's history. There are various pioneering groups displaying the clothing and tools used long ago as well as music and dancing. Some individuals wear authentic cowboy outfits along with their six-shooters, in addition there are a variety of individuals showing off other style clothing worn during pioneer days. There are displays showing how things were made; for example, fabric, quilts, wooden tools, and many others. There is folk music, dancing, exhibits, games, lots of good food and friendly people to make for a great experience. Location: Bastrop, TX. For more information visit the Yesterfest website. |
